Output 751096c598007be7777ddb20b6e5ef740c4b1f8d90311606673e42eb4b2126fe:1

value
39418215
script pubkey
OP_0 OP_PUSHBYTES_32 1af1cc20eaf8160a6e8275b9100ba64dfc16ad03b490a1eca916797e368cba57
address
bc1qrtcucg82lqtq5m5zwku3qzaxfh7pdtgrkjg2rm9fzeuhud5vhfts5ffhvz
transaction
751096c598007be7777ddb20b6e5ef740c4b1f8d90311606673e42eb4b2126fe
spent
true